 The cloning system of nuclear transfer was to start with Utilized in mice in 1983, even though it took the first cells from embryos and produced no living animal. Improvements in working with nuclei from cells in lifestyle triggered cloned calf embryos in 1994, after which you can the true breakthrough arrived when Wilmut’s team accomplished nuclear transfer from an established cell line in 1996. Dolly’s uniqueness was that she was cloned from an adult cell, so overriding the likely ethical and moral baggage hooked up to employing (and destroying) early embryos. Prior to 1960, Just about not a soul thought that the continents moved, but a series of papers in Nature improved how the world was viewed. As new rock types, the direction of Earth’s magnetic area is imprinted in its ferrous aspects. However the magnetic ‘stripes’ (pictured) that shaped as being the poles periodically reversed did not tally in rocks from different continents — so either the magnetic poles were wandering, or The ocean flooring was shifting. Frederick Vine and Drum Matthews’s seven September 1963 paper on sea-flooring magnetism constructed on important observations produced by Other individuals, including Keith Runcorn and Robert Dietz a decade before.
